Force is an … WebMar 26, 2016 · In physics, when frictional forces are acting on a sloped surface such as a ramp, the angle of the ramp tilts the normal force at an angle. When you work out the frictional forces, you need to take this fact into account. Normal force, N, is the force that pushes up against an object, perpendicular to the surface the object is resting on. fish\u0026meat hands

A flat belt is any system where the pulley or surface only interacts with the bottom surface of the belt or cable. If the belt or cable instead fits into a groove, then it is considered a V belt.
